A Graduate Certificate in Identifying Seizures in Children holds significant importance in today's UK healthcare market. The rising prevalence of epilepsy in children necessitates skilled professionals capable of accurate diagnosis and management. According to the Epilepsy Action charity, approximately 87,000 children in the UK live with epilepsy. This translates to a considerable need for healthcare professionals with specialized expertise in pediatric seizure recognition. Early and accurate identification is crucial for effective treatment and improved patient outcomes. The certificate program equips learners with the necessary knowledge and skills to meet this demand, bridging the gap between existing expertise and the rising need for pediatric epilepsy specialists.
